Abstract

Thermal stability of the Fe 80−xCr xB 20 ( x = 10,15,20) metallic glasses, produced by the single-roll melt spinning method, have been investigated by means of the EEE and DTA techniques. A comparison of the results of the EEE and DTA measurements shows clearly that the surface crystallization occurs at a temperature ∼150 K lower than the temperature of volume crystallization. The activation energy for the surface crystallization is also distinctly lower than that for crystallization in bulk.
